Autodesk Signs Agreement With Avid Technology to Acquire Softimage
October 23, 2008
Autodesk and Avid Technology, announced that they have signed a definitive agreement for Autodesk to acquire substantially all of the assets of Avid’s Softimage business unit for approximately $35 million.
